What Is the 9 of Swords Reversed in Tarot?
The 9 of Swords is traditionally associated with feelings of despair, confusion, and overwhelming stress. It reflects a state where the mind feels consumed by endless worries, self-doubt, and a sense of helplessness. However, when the card appears reversed—with the intuitive weight flipped—it transforms into a message of awakening, self-reflection, and potential transformation.

Symbolic Meaning: From Distress to Discernment
The Traditional 9 of Swords: Stress and Mental Turmoil
Normally, the 9 of Swords signifies:
- Mental exhaustion from overthinking or fear
- Emotional overwhelm, especially triggered by deception or betrayal
- A sense of stagnation or paralysis in decision-making
- Hyper vigilance, anxiety, or mental “paralysis by analysis”
But when reversed, the card shifts from passive suffering to active confrontation—challenging you to face what you’ve been avoiding.
What Reversing Means: From Stagnation to Clarity
The reversal flips the narrative from one of helplessness to one of self-awareness and reevaluation. It asks: What in your life feels overwhelmingly stagnant? What assumptions or fears are keeping you stuck? Rather than being defined by despair, 9 of Swords Reversed invites you to examine the patterns fueling your turmoil with fresh eyes.

Psychological and Spiritual Insights
Psychologically, this card often signals a need for emotional release. It urges you to break free from cycles of rumination and negative thought patterns. Spiritually, it can represent a call to trust deeper intuition rather than being ruled by intellectual or emotional overwhelm.
Therapists and spiritual guides often associate reversed 9 of Swords with a turning point—where staying stuck becomes unsustainable, and the path forward emerges through honest introspection.
Reversed 9 of Swords in Various Contexts
- Love & Relationships: You may be trapped in uncertainty or self-doubt about a partnership. But rather than avoiding commitment, this card invites emotional honesty about your fears and what you truly need.
- Career & Ambition: Feeling paralyzed by error or indecision? Reversed 9 of Swords suggests that avoidance is no longer sustainable—facing risks with clearer intention is required.
- Personal Growth: This marker often appears just before personal transformation—when mental clutter dissolves, clarity follows.
